Measuring biochemical oxygen demand necessitates getting two measurements. A person is measured immediately for dissolved oxygen (First), and the next is incubated within the lab for five times after which you can tested for the amount of dissolved oxygen remaining (remaining).

Expanding BOD has exactly the same impact as the effects of dissolved depleting oxygen. In the event the BOD of a water overall body increases noticeably, aquatic life click here is adversely influenced. The oxygen employed by aquatic organisms for respiration and metabolism is appreciably decreased by the microbes for breaking down of organic and natural waste.

The stream system both equally generates and consumes oxygen. It gains oxygen in the ambiance and from crops because of photosynthesis.
